  1. If people are interested in this system then the only book avaiablke is "The Railways and Locomotives of the Lilleshall Company, by Bob Yates. Irwell Press 2008.

    After the closure of the steelworks most of the site was cleared but in the 1960,s as a student I worked at what was left, a block making plant, using power station ash.

    The first photo shows the ex GWR Pannier tank bought by the company.

    Some of the locos built by the Lilleshall Company survived for many years working on lighter duties and the next photo shows one of its own built in 1869 and being scrapped in 1950attachicon.gifLillershall No 6 built by them 1869, re built 1923. Scrapped 22-4-1950.jpg.

     

    After the NCB took over the collieries owned by the Company Granville Colliery supplied coal to Buildwas Powere station and the coal trains were worked by a range of locos down the 1.5 miles to Donnington station. Granville Colliery had a decent sized shed and in later years used Austerity 0-6-0tanks but in Lilleshall Company days the bigger engines were the ex TVR and Barry railway engines.
